Fully-integrated browser AI

Issue 2 2025 News & Events

Opera is adding its free browser AI, Aria, to Opera Mini, its popular Android-based browser with over 100 million users across the world. This update brings powerful AI capabilities, such as up-to-date information from the web, research assistance, content summarisation, and image generation, directly into the browser at no additional cost.

“AI is rapidly becoming an integral part of the daily internet experience, and we are seeing a great interest in AI solutions among South Africans, so bringing Aria to Opera Mini is a natural addition to our most-downloaded browser. With the integration of our built-in AI, we are excited to explore how AI can further enhance the feature set our South African users rely on every day,” said Jørgen Arnesen, EVP Mobile at Opera.

Opera Mini is known and appreciated for numerous unique features – from live football scores to the built-in digital wallet MiniPay, and now also Aria.

Addressing data costs

While internet access is becoming more available for South Africans, the cost of the internet is disproportionately high compared to the income or GDP per capita. According to an Opera survey from March 2025, 80% of South Africans said data is too expensive, and over two-thirds (69%) reported regularly running out of data before the end of the month. Data costs remain a key concern in the country.

For years, Opera Mini has played a role in improving internet accessibility across South Africa. Opera Mini’s turbo data-saving mode can reduce data usage by up to 90% compared to other major browsers. For the past three years, Opera has saved South Africans an equivalent of $10 million in data (6 million GB) through its data compression technology. The free data campaigns, active since 2020, allow South Africans using Opera Mini on the MTN network to benefit from 3 GB each month for free, which can be used for anything, including interacting with Aria. Since 2022, Opera has invested millions of dollars in free data campaigns in South Africa, bridging the digital divide and ensuring information access.

With Aria integrated into Opera Mini, users get the benefits of an advanced AI tool without sacrificing data. Aria is optimised for minimal data consumption and is included within Opera’s free daily data bundles in South Africa.

Aria, Opera’s native built-in AI

Aria browser AI integrates into Opera's browsers on both desktop and mobile to enable an accessible chat-based interface with AI. It enhances user interaction through information retrieval, text or code generation, image generation and understanding. Aria is powered by Opera’s own Composer AI engine, which utilises both OpenAI and Google AI technologies to provide the most relevant answers, and it integrates image generation through Google’s Imagen3 fast model.

Aria is now available across all Opera browsers. Opera Mini can be downloaded or updated via the Google Play Store, with Aria available in the browser.
